At an altitude of 800 m, surrounded by cane fields, the town of Trois-Bassins has kept its authentic Creole character and its quiet and nonchalant way of life. The municipal territory has a difference in altitude of nearly 3,000 m, from the coast to the Grand Bénare, "from the beat of the blades to the top of the mountains". But it is in the shape of a strip 15 km long and only 2 to 3 km wide. Most motorists drive through the commune of Trois-Bassins without noticing it. Despite a population of more than 7,000 souls, this large town has little tourist interest, but it is a nice stopover if you drive along the Hubert Delisle road.
